Without doubt the best – albeit also the most bank-busting - place to stay in Budapest, and one of Europe's finest hotels, full stop.
Originally built in 1906 for the Gresham Life Insurance Company (hence the official name the Four Seasons Gresham Palace Hotel), the latter day Four Seasons is an Art Nouveau masterpiece.
Despite occupying probably the finest location in the city - right opposite the iconic Chain Bridge, by the 90s the building was desperately in need of a face lift. Fortunately help (and a very large cheque) was at hand and after six years under wraps the palace re-emerged in its latest guise as a hotel in 2004. The results are, quite simply, spectacular.
Despite the eye-watering price tag, we at Original Travel believe it was money extremely well spent. What welcomes guests now is one of Europe's finest urban hotels, from the beautiful mosaic-inlaid (to a design by Frank Lloyd Wright, no less) entrance hall to the service in the fine restaurants and the extremely comfortable bedrooms. The rooms are a minimum of 350 square foot and all have king size beds and well-appointed bathrooms. All guests have the run of the spa and gym on the top floor, as well as the indoor infinity pool.
The location is also a big bonus as the main city sites are all within 20 minutes walk, and the leathery uplit snugness of the bar is a welcoming retreat after a hard day's sightseeing.
Rarely can a renovation have been so thorough and under-taken with such attention to detail, but that's probably to be expected from a budget of $85 million.
